Transaction 21483eda46615fe8ae0d66bc0b19caa4196cf4ffc840555e4c4031b16283f8fb

1 Input
2 Outputs
  • 21483eda46615fe8ae0d66bc0b19caa4196cf4ffc840555e4c4031b16283f8fb:0
  • value  1039984
    address  3EWXkDda4HiWPvs8tgwHbD3o523eJkM4eW
  • 21483eda46615fe8ae0d66bc0b19caa4196cf4ffc840555e4c4031b16283f8fb:1
  • value  3434041
    address  38xpkmpDmUMv9Z8MWfG8tC1CoNqBCbCDYP